($744) Cost to ship a car from Fayetteville, NC to New Haven, CT
Quick answer: On average, moving a car 621 miles from Fayetteville, North Carolina, to New Haven, Connecticut, will run you about $744 to $975. How we chose the best car shipping companies
We analyzed 2,400 car shipping companies nationally and evaluated and rated them based on key factors using our unique system of methodology.
Here’s what we considered:
- Standard services: We looked at the types and variety of services each company provides. This includes whether they offer open transport, enclosed transport, or both. We also rated companies based on whether they have door-to-door shipping or just terminal pickup and delivery and the kinds of vehicles they ship. Companies that move RVs, motorcycles, and other specialty vehicles scored higher than those that just ship cars.
- Add-on services: We gave additional points to companies that provide special optional services like expedited shipping, guaranteed pickup times, car washes, and rental car reimbursement.
- Customer satisfaction: We analyzed consumer reviews on multiple major platforms, such as Yelp, Google, and Trustpilot to see whether a car shipping company delivers services promptly with good communication and within the estimated cost. We also evaluated each company’s standing within the car shipping industry as a whole by confirming U.S. Department of Transportation (USDOT) licensure and checked their membership in — and reputation with — trade associations.
- Availability: We awarded points to each company based on their service areas. Companies that are available in Alaska and Hawaii, in addition to the continental U.S., scored higher than those that just service the Lower 48 or fewer states.
- Scheduling and payment: We reviewed the ease with which customers can schedule services and estimate their costs through accurate quotes, price matching, flat-rate pricing, and other perks. Car shippers that give binding quotes or a price-lock promise got more positive rankings than those that are not as transparent with pricing.
Car shipping alternatives from NC to CT
When you’re moving from Fayetteville to New Haven, there are several ways to get your car to your new home. Here are the most common car shipping alternatives. Each one has its own benefits and trade-offs.
Coordinate with your movers
When relocating from Fayetteville to New Haven, most of the top-rated moving companies can bundle auto transport into your move by partnering with national car shippers. The trade-off is convenience versus flexibility, since you’ll be tied to their carrier of choice and rates.
Drive your car
Choosing whether to drive or ship your vehicle involves trade-offs. The 621 miles from Fayetteville to New Haven might make for an enjoyable road trip and save you money. But the downsides include added wear on your car and potential risks from weather or long-distance driving.
Use a driving service
You could hire a professional driver to take your car from North Carolina to Connecticut, though this tends to be a pricey choice. You’ll also need to ensure the driver is reliable enough to get your car from Fayetteville to New Haven safely. Keep in mind, this option still adds mileage to your vehicle.
Ship your car via train
Shipping a car by train is a cost-effective and safe way to transport your vehicle to New Haven, particularly if you’re already planning to move your household belongings by rail. In fact, it is the cheapest way to ship your car! Keep in mind that this method offers no real flexibility in terms of pickup and drop-off locations and will take longer than using a car shipper or driving.
Factors affecting Fayetteville to New Haven car shipping costs
When transporting your vehicle from Fayetteville to New Haven, these factors will influence the cost:
Transport method
If you’re moving a car from Fayetteville to New Haven, your options include open, enclosed, and top-loaded shipping. Each service has pros and cons depending on your situation.
Open carriers from Fayetteville tend to be the most budget-friendly, while enclosed transport is better for protecting luxury or classic cars. To help you decide on the right choice for your move to New Haven, see our detailed guide on open vs. enclosed transport.
Vehicle size and type
Your shipping costs out of Fayetteville will be determined in large part by what kind of car you have. As you might guess, the bigger the vehicle, the more it will cost. This is simply because it takes up more space and adds more weight to the carrier. So, a full-size SUV will be more expensive to ship to New Haven than a compact car.
Distance and route
Basically, longer distances mean higher shipping prices. Extra miles drive up fuel usage, labor hours, tolls, and maintenance costs. So moving your car 621 miles from Fayetteville to New Haven will almost always cost more than a shorter in-state trip in North Carolina.
Location also affects the cost. Shipments along common interstate routes are typically cheaper, while hard-to-reach destinations add to the price.
The time of the year
The time of year and weather conditions in Fayetteville and New Haven play a major role in determining car shipping rates.
May, October and April are the best months to move in Fayetteville, while you need to reconsider your plans on July and August.
Best months to move to New Haven are June, September and August as these are the best months with tolerable weather. January and February are the least comfortable months as these are the coldest months.
For example, peak moving seasons like summer and the holidays increase demand, which pushes prices higher. Shipping your car from Fayetteville to New Haven in those months will likely cost more than during slower seasons.
Fuel prices
Fluctuating fuel prices are one of the biggest elements affecting car shipping costs. On the 621-mile drive between Fayetteville and New Haven, even small changes at the pump can make a difference. When fuel rates rise, so do shipping charges.
Delivery expectations
Being flexible with your delivery dates can sometimes lead to discounts from your auto shipper. However, shipping a car from Fayetteville to New Haven typically takes between one and six days. Flexibility in delivery times can save costs, whereas expedited services ensure quicker delivery but at a premium cost.

Car insurance requirements
- Fayetteville: Ensure compliance with North Carolina's mandatory minimum liability insurance rules for drivers. Your coverage should meet or exceed $30,000 for bodily injury per person, $60,000 for bodily injury per accident, and $25,000 for property damage per accident. Don't forget to enhance your protection with uninsured/underinsured motorist coverage. Stay informed and safeguarded on the road by meeting these state insurance requirements.
- New Haven: The basic car insurance requirements in the state of Connecticut is as follow: Bodily injury liability: $25,000 per person, $50,000 per accident Property damage liability: $25,000 per accident Uninsured/underinsured motorist: $25,000 per person, $50,000 per accident
Vehicle inspections
- Fayetteville: Before the North Carolina DMV can register a passenger vehicle, it must pass an annual safety inspection if it is less than 30 years old.
- New Haven: In Connecticut, all vehicles must undergo an emissions inspection every two years, with a few exceptions. Additionally, a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) inspection, which confirms the vehicle's identity, is required when registering the vehicle in the state.
Driver’s license
- Fayetteville: New residents in North Carolina are obligated to transfer their license or ID within 60 days of moving to the state.
- New Haven: As a new resident of Connecticut, you must obtain a Connecticut driver's license within 30 days. Residency is defined as living in the state for over 6 months in a year.
FAQ
How much does it cost to ship a car from Fayetteville to New Haven?
The cost to ship a car from Fayetteville, NC to New Haven, CT varies based on several factors, including the type of transport (open vs. enclosed car shipping), vehicle size and weight, and the current fuel prices. On average, transporting your vehicle from Fayetteville to New Haven will range from $744 to $975.
How long will it take to ship my car from Fayetteville to New Haven?
It will take approximately one to six days to ship your car the 621 miles from Fayetteville to New Haven. If you need it quicker, ask your shipper about expedited delivery.
What’s the cheapest way to ship my car from Fayetteville to New Haven?
An open-transport car carrier is the cheapest way to ship your car from Fayetteville to New Haven. However, there are other methods. Read our post on the cheapest way to ship a car to learn more.
Is it cheaper to ship my car or drive it from Fayetteville to New Haven?
It is generally cheaper to drive your car from Fayetteville to New Haven than to ship it. However, when deciding whether to drive your car or ship it, you need to factor in related costs like maintenance fees that could result from the additional wear-and-tear on your vehicle during the 621-mile trip. Long-distance trips also involve food and possibly lodging, which can add up quickly.
